Thanks for all the work Mallard...but that leaves me with some questions about:
AS95008
903 SPECIAL CHECK TRADE FAIR/PHOTO VEHICLE
991 PRE-SERIES MANAGEMENT

If in your journeys you have come across these before, maybe you could shed some light on them.

After some research, I found out from a buddy who is an exec at Ford, special codes are available for internally ordered cars for management that flag a car for tighter production tolerances (panel gap, extra clear coat etc). These cars do not have to be
PDIed by a dealer prior to delivery as it is all prepped in advance from the production line. There is a good chance my car was originally a BMW exec ordered car...doesn't add value, but kind of different.
